The retrospective audit identifies a concrete perception-framing mechanism in Conservative Accountability Project's public messaging.
From CAP converts broad appropriation votes into issue-specific 'anti-law-enforcement/veterans/prisons' messaging (2026-09-16). Recorded status: MESSAGING MECHANISM VERIFIED: CAP reduces whole-budget votes to issue labels. Accuracy/motive depends on full context; no deception, coordination, or Article IV direction is established. Its filings report two $37,500 general-support grants to Votes Idaho Company in 2022 and 2023 ($75,000 total), followed in 2024 by $2,220,000 to Idahoans for Open Primaries and $25,000 to Boise-based Conservative Accountability Project.
